#1ab2ef h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#1ab2ef is composed of 10.2% red, 69.8% green and 93.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.1% cyan, 25.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 197.2 degrees, a saturation of 86.9% and a lightness of 52%. #1ab2ef color hex could be obtained by blending #34ffff with #0065df. Closest websafe color is: #3399ff.

● #1ab2ef color description : Vivid blue.
The hexadecimal color #1ab2ef has RGB values of R:26, G:178, B:239 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0.26, Y:0,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 1749743.
